What is a PPEC?

PPEC stands for Prescribed Pediatric Extended Care. These services provide a less restrictive, cost-effective alternative to expensive hospitalization or home health care. It reduces the isolation of home-bound programs, helping each child to achieve the highest quality of life possible.

What qualifies a child for the PPEC program?

Children who need nursing care every day and are unable to have their needs met by a typical school or day care and/or do not need to be in a hospital. Children who have been hospitalized or frequent emergency room visits for an ongoing or unresolved condition such as asthma or seizures.

Who pays for these services?

PPEC Services are covered by Medicaid once recommended by the child’s pediatrician through a prescription or letter of medical necessity. We also accept insurance and private pay. Our staff is happy to assist you with the enrollment process.
